- The distance between Pedernales, Dominican Republic and Vrfu Omu, Romania is approximately 9,131 km or 5,674 mi.
- To reach Pedernales in this distance one would set out from Vrfu Omu bearing 287.7°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Pedernales bearing 224.6° or SW .
- Pedernales has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Vrfu Omu has a tundra climate (ET).
- Pedernales is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Vrfu Omu is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 30.1 °C (54.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.6 °C (20.9°F) less in Pedernales.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 555.4 mm (21.9 in) less which is equivalent to 555.4 l/m² (13.63 US gal/ft²) or 5,554,000 l/ha (593,759 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 25.7° higher in Pedernales than in Vrfu Omu.
